PolitiFact reviewed Nexis news archives and Google search results and found no credible reporting to support this viral post.

But none exist.

The claim appears to have originated on a self-proclaimed satire Facebook account, The Satire Times, the day before the viral post.

It was widely reshared without a satire label on Facebook and Threads.

Less than three years ago, Musk promoted Tesla’s support of its LGBTQ+ employees by noting it was ranked highly in the Human Rights Campaign Corporate Equality Index, which measures LGBTQ+ workplace policies.

During an LGBTQ pride parade in Los Angeles, someone attempted to slay the house down in a Cybertruck with rainbow wrapping — a hilarious bit of irony during the colorful celebration that the notoriously-bigoted Elon Musk would absolutely despise.

As shown in videos and photos posted to social media from the parade in LA’s ritzy West Hollywood “gayborhood,” the pride-themed truck clearly turned heads among the giant crowd gathered for the festival.

It also drew jibes on the r/TeslaMotors subreddit in which commentators joked that it looked “like a mango going ripe” and was “one of the least hideous” Cybertrucks out there.

Others on the platform, and on the Musk-owned X-formerly-Twitter, however, pointed out how much the bigoted multi-hyphenate billionaire would hate one of his company’s cars being used for such a celebration.

“Don’t feed Elon’s ego,” one Redditor commented.

As has been extensivelydocumented, Musk’s penchant for transphobia, while relatively recent, would certainly put him at odds with the message the rainbow-wrapped Cybertruck is sending.

Musk’s anti-trans bigotry is all the more troubling considering that one of his daughters is transgender — though she, notably, wants nothing to do with him, and her transition may, as writer Walter Isaacson alleged in his biography of the billionaire that came out last fall, have “triggered” her infamous father’s transphobia.

Back before he became the brain-wormed billionaire we all know and loathe, Musk’s companies used to be considered great places for LGBTQ people to work.

But PolitiFact could find no evidence that Musk is prohibiting Cybertruck sales to LGBTQ+ people or that he made this statement.

Musk’s actions are currently under scrutiny because of his role in President Donald Trump’s administration as head of the Department of Government Efficiency, so if Musk made this announcement, it would have made headlines. PolitiFact also found no statements made by Musk or Tesla on X or the Tesla website.
